Step-by-step explanation
The formula to find density is m/v=p
m=mass
v=volume
p=density
<h3>---------------------------</h3>
All we have to do is plug in 6g and 20cm^3
This will give us 6/20 which simplifies to 3/10
With this you can easily figure out that the decimal for 3/10 is 0.3
So the density of the ice is <u>0.3</u>
